Understanding Knee Pain and Swelling

Knee pain and swelling are common complaints that can arise from a variety of causes, including acute injuries (e.g., sprains, meniscal tears, ligament damage), overuse syndromes (e.g., patellofemoral pain syndrome, tendinitis), and chronic conditions such as osteoarthritis, rheumatoid arthritis, or gout. Swelling, specifically, is often a sign of inflammation or fluid accumulation within the joint, which can exacerbate pain and limit mobility. Effective medication aims to address both the pain and the underlying inflammation.

Over-the-Counter (OTC) Medications

For many cases of mild to moderate knee pain and swelling, OTC medications are the first line of defense due to their accessibility and generally favorable safety profile when used as directed.

  • Non-Steroidal Anti-Inflammatory Drugs (NSAIDs):
    • Mechanism: NSAIDs work by inhibiting enzymes (COX-1 and COX-2) that are involved in the production of prostaglandins, chemicals that promote inflammation, pain, and fever. By reducing prostaglandin synthesis, NSAIDs effectively decrease both pain and swelling.
    • Examples: Common OTC NSAIDs include ibuprofen (e.g., Advil, Motrin) and naproxen (e.g., Aleve).
    • Considerations: While effective, NSAIDs can have side effects, particularly gastrointestinal upset (heartburn, ulcers), and may pose risks for individuals with kidney disease, heart conditions, or high blood pressure. They should be used at the lowest effective dose for the shortest duration necessary.
  • Acetaminophen (Paracetamol):
    • Mechanism: Acetaminophen (e.g., Tylenol) primarily acts as a pain reliever and fever reducer, though its exact mechanism is not fully understood. Unlike NSAIDs, it has minimal anti-inflammatory effects.
    • Use: It is suitable for pain relief when inflammation is not the primary issue or when NSAIDs are contraindicated.
    • Considerations: Excessive dosing can lead to liver damage, so strict adherence to recommended dosages is crucial.
  • Topical Analgesics:
    • Mechanism: These are creams, gels, patches, or sprays applied directly to the skin over the affected knee. They work by delivering active ingredients locally, minimizing systemic side effects.
    • Examples:
      • Topical NSAIDs (e.g., diclofenac gel): Some topical NSAIDs are available OTC or by prescription and can provide localized anti-inflammatory and pain relief with lower systemic absorption than oral NSAIDs.
      • Counterirritants (e.g., menthol, camphor, capsaicin): These create a sensation (cooling, warming, or mild irritation) that distracts from the pain signals. Capsaicin, derived from chili peppers, can also deplete substance P, a neurotransmitter involved in pain transmission, over time.
    • Use: Ideal for localized pain, especially for those who experience systemic side effects from oral medications.

Prescription Medications

When OTC options are insufficient or for more severe or chronic conditions, a healthcare provider may prescribe stronger medications.

  • Stronger Oral NSAIDs: Higher doses or different formulations of NSAIDs may be prescribed for more intense pain or inflammation.
  • Corticosteroids (Oral and Injections):
    • Mechanism: Corticosteroids are powerful anti-inflammatory agents that mimic hormones produced by the adrenal glands. They rapidly reduce inflammation and immune responses.
    • Oral Corticosteroids: Used for short-term, acute flare-ups of inflammation.
    • Intra-articular Injections (Cortisone Shots): A corticosteroid is injected directly into the knee joint. This provides potent, localized anti-inflammatory relief, often effective for osteoarthritis flares, bursitis, or tendinitis.
    • Considerations: While highly effective, repeated or long-term use of corticosteroids, especially oral forms, carries risks such as bone thinning, weight gain, increased blood sugar, and weakened immune function. Injections are typically limited to a few times per year due to potential cartilage damage with excessive use.
  • Hyaluronic Acid Injections (Viscosupplementation):
    • Mechanism: Hyaluronic acid is a natural component of healthy joint fluid, acting as a lubricant and shock absorber. Injections of synthetic hyaluronic acid aim to supplement the joint fluid, improving lubrication and reducing friction.
    • Use: Primarily for osteoarthritis, where the natural joint fluid may be degraded. It does not directly reduce inflammation but can improve pain and function.
    • Considerations: Effects are typically gradual and may not be immediate. Not effective for all patients.
  • Disease-Modifying Anti-Rheumatic Drugs (DMARDs):
    • Mechanism: For inflammatory conditions like rheumatoid arthritis, DMARDs work by modifying the immune system to slow the progression of the disease and reduce joint damage.
    • Use: Prescribed by rheumatologists for specific autoimmune conditions.
    • Examples: Methotrexate, sulfasalazine, and biologics (e.g., adalimumab, etanercept).
  • Opioids:
    • Mechanism: Opioids (e.g., tramadol, oxycodone) act on opioid receptors in the brain and spinal cord to reduce the perception of pain. They do not address inflammation.
    • Use: Reserved for severe, acute pain, typically post-surgery or severe injury, for a very limited duration.
    • Considerations: High risk of side effects including constipation, nausea, sedation, and significant risk of dependence, addiction, and overdose. Their use for chronic non-cancer pain is highly discouraged due to these risks.

Beyond Medication: Holistic Management of Knee Pain

While medication plays a crucial role, it is often most effective when integrated into a broader management strategy that addresses the biomechanical and lifestyle factors contributing to knee pain.

  • RICE Protocol (for acute injuries): Rest, Ice, Compression, and Elevation are fundamental for initial management of acute knee injuries to reduce swelling and pain.
  • Physical Therapy and Exercise: A cornerstone of knee pain management. A physical therapist can design a program to:
    • Strengthen muscles: Quadriceps, hamstrings, glutes, and core muscles to improve joint stability and reduce load on the knee.
    • Improve flexibility: Address muscle imbalances and joint stiffness.
    • Enhance proprioception and balance: Improve neuromuscular control around the knee.
  • Weight Management: Losing excess body weight significantly reduces the load on the knee joints, which can dramatically decrease pain and slow the progression of conditions like osteoarthritis.
  • Supportive Devices: Braces, knee sleeves, or custom orthotics can provide support, stability, or improve alignment, reducing stress on the joint.
  • Activity Modification: Adjusting activities to avoid movements that exacerbate pain while maintaining an active lifestyle.

When to See a Doctor

It's important to consult a healthcare professional for knee pain and swelling if:

  • The pain is severe or prevents you from bearing weight.
  • The knee appears deformed or you heard a "pop" at the time of injury.
  • Swelling is significant or rapidly worsens.
  • You experience fever, redness, or warmth around the joint, which could indicate infection.
  • Symptoms do not improve with conservative home care and OTC medications after a few days.
  • Knee pain is chronic or recurrent.
